tertĭātĭo
            
          
          tertĭātĭo, ōnis, f. tertiatus, a doing a thing the third time; concr., that which is produced by a third operation: miscere tertiationem cum primā pressurā, the oil produced by the third pressure, Col. 12, 52, 11.
